History claims that alarm clocks have actually been around for centuries already, although they only became very popular during the 19th century. This is because the Industrial Revolution required all workers to report for work on time. In 1940, a patent request was approved for the modern clock radio which can play music or a buzzing sound in order to wake up the user.

As mentioned, clock radios include an alarm system of some sort that you can use to help you get up. There is a large snooze button that you can hit if you don’t want to get up yet and would like an additional five to ten minutes of sleep.

There are clock radios with CD player that can play your favorite music as an alarm instead of the traditional buzzer sound. You could also set the clock to turn on to your favorite radio station to help you get up. Most people actually prefer waking up to music they enjoy instead of incessant buzzing sounds.

An added feature automatically turns off the music after an hour, which is useful for those who have a tendency to forget to shut off the alarm. There are also those that have a sleep function that will play music while you fall asleep. The radio will turn off by itself at the time that you set.

A good thing about a clock radio is that it has a back-up battery so that you won’t need to reset the time during black-outs or sudden power outages.

The functionality varies from one clock to another. There are lots of different styles to choose from, though the most popular one remains are those with LED displays. A good thing to remember when looking for clock radios for sale is to choose one that has good, high-quality speakers. This will ensure that the music will be played clearly at the volume you prefer. Nothing can be more annoying than waking up to fuzzy-sounding music which you can barely hear.

Make sure you do research before buying a clock radio so that you can buy the one that is right for you. Once you get it, read all the labels on the clock switches and dials so that you can easily operate the clock even with low lighting.
